Transaction 868ff91abfd7f62b450c487abbd4c73792f8880bc2af0878acb39cb343111a9c

1 Input
2 Outputs
  • 868ff91abfd7f62b450c487abbd4c73792f8880bc2af0878acb39cb343111a9c:0
  • value  16321201
    address  13WG12ezVrnwCpu7UxdoTqdapFgYfBmYv5
  • 868ff91abfd7f62b450c487abbd4c73792f8880bc2af0878acb39cb343111a9c:1
  • value  74577799
    address  17C9xPyw8QX89xWQY7Y8X2wFFzAqrfTraL